Lehigh Cement Bantam Kings Declared 2019/20 OMHA Co-Champions
Prince Edward County Minor Hockey Association is extremely proud to announce that our Lehigh Cement Bantam B Rep Kings have been declared the 2019/20 Hockey Season OMHA All Ontario #RedHat Co-Champions!!

In a public article posted on the OMHA website on Saturday April 11, 2020 the OMHA released that they will be awarding the coveted #RedHats to all of the teams that reached the Finals of the OMHA Playdowns in 2020.

“Our goal is to be positive and proactive in a trying environment by rewarding the players and teams who deservedly made it that far through the highly competitive Playdowns,” says Ian Taylor, OMHA Executive Director. “It’s a simple gesture, but hopefully a meaningful one, as well.”

PECMHA has not had an All Ontario Champion team in many years. We are very proud and excited for all of the players, staff and families involved with this team throughout the season. Congratulations!!

PECMHA will ensure there is much celebration and recognition surrounding our All Ontario Champions once the COVID-19 social distancing has been lifted and we can congregate in groups once again.
